Opinion of the Court
The opinion of the court was delivered March 19th 1883.
— When the plaintiffs testator accepted a purpart of the land, it will not be presumed that he kept alive a lien on the land, which he had himself agreed to pay. Hence-a judgment against him bound his entire interest in the land, and by virtue of the sheriff’s sale it passed to the purchaser.
Judgment affirmed.
